Choose the Right Cleaning Method

When it comes to cleaning your curtains, the first step is to determine the appropriate cleaning method based on the fabric type. For machine-washable curtains, make sure to follow the care instructions on the label and use a gentle cycle with mild detergent to prevent shrinkage or color fading.

Maintain Your Curtains Regularly

In addition to regular cleaning, it’s important to maintain your curtains regularly to prevent dirt and dust buildup. Vacuuming your curtains once a week can help remove surface dust and allergens, while spot cleaning with a damp cloth can address any stains or spills promptly. By incorporating these simple maintenance tasks into your cleaning routine, you can ensure that your curtains stay fresh and in top condition for years to come.
